Barbara A. (Perrone) Martone, 89, of Worcester, passed away on Thursday, May 14, 2026 at Saint Mary Healthcare in Worcester. Her husband, Anthony Martone, predeceased her in January of 2015.
Barbara is survived by her loving son, Michael A. Martone and his wife Michelle of Uxbridge; six grandchildren, Maximus, Macen, and Mazzy Martone, Kerrianne, Gianna, and Anthony Gabrie1la; several great grandchildren; many nieces and nephews. Barbara was predeceased by her daughter, Cheryl Gabriella in 2006. Barbara was born in Worcester, daughter of the late, Samuel and Rose (Gabriella) Perrone, and has lived here all her life. She graduated from Worcester High School of Commerce.
Barbara worked as a medical secretary in the Oncology Department at Saint Vincent Hospital for many years before retiring. She was a member of Our Lady of Loreto Church, she enjoyed dancing, bowling, going to Maine, and was an enthusiastic Red Sox fan. Her favorite past time was entertaining and being with her family for the holidays.
Barbara’s family would like to thank the incredible staff at Saint Mary Healthcare for their kindness and compassion. A special thank you is also extended to Ascend Hospice for their care and diligence in keeping Barbara’s dignity and comfort.
Calling Hours will on Thursday, May 21, in Our Lady of Loreto Church, from 9:30 am until her Funeral Mass begins at 11 am at Our Lady of Loreto Church Our Lady of Mount Carmel, 37 Massasoit Road, Worcester. Interment will follow at Saint John’s Cemetery.
In lieu of flowers, donations in her memory may be made to Saint Mary Healthcare, 39 Queen Street, Worcester, MA 01610.
